.mw300{max-width:300px!important}.mw400{max-width:400px!important}.mw500{max-width:500px!important}.mw600{max-width:600px!important}.small{font-size:.85em}.q-card{box-shadow:1px 5px 15px rgba(0,0,0,.1);width:100%}.q-btn--rectangle{border-radius:10px}.q-card__section:empty{padding:0}.q-btn--flat{box-shadow:none}.q-form.form-card .q-field .q-field__control{height:auto;padding:8px 16px}.q-form.form-card .q-field--with-bottom{padding-bottom:0}.q-form.form-card .q-btn-toggle .q-btn{border-radius:0;padding:16px}.bg-white-opacity{background-color:hsla(0,0%,100%,.6)}.bg-online-opacity{background-color:hsla(0,0%,100%,.9)}.bg-offline-opacity{background-color:hsla(5,100%,75%,.9)}.bg-map{background-image:url(/statics/bg.png);background-position:50%;background-size:cover}.text-muted{color:#666}.q-field--outlined .q-field__control:before{border-width:2px}.q-field--standard .q-field__control:before{border-color:#eee;border-width:2px}.q-card{box-shadow:1px 1px 8px rgba(0,0,0,.2)}.q-card .cta{padding:20px 10px;width:100%}#visit .q-item,.q-list-special .q-item{background-color:#f5f5f5;border-radius:3px;margin:6px;padding:15px}#visit .q-item .q-icon,.q-list-special .q-item .q-icon{color:#fff;font-size:2em}#visit .q-item .item-title,.q-list-special .q-item .item-title{font-weight:700;line-height:1.1em}#visit .q-item .item-value,.q-list-special .q-item .item-value{color:#fff;font-size:1.3em;font-weight:700}#visit .q-item .q-badge .q-icon,.q-list-special .q-item .q-badge .q-icon{font-size:12px!important}#visit .bg-vt-green,.q-list-special .bg-vt-green{background-color:#60d461}#visit .bg-vt-blue,.q-list-special .bg-vt-blue{background-color:#73d1db}#visit .bg-vt-yellow,.q-list-special .bg-vt-yellow{background-color:#ffc05e}#visit .bg-vt-red,.q-list-special .bg-vt-red{background-color:#f44336}#visit .instructions{text-align:center}#visit .instructions p{margin:0}#visit .actions{padding:16px;text-align:center}#visit .actions:empty{padding:0}.bg-vt-green{background-color:#60d461}.bg-vt-blue{background-color:#73d1db}.bg-vt-yellow{background-color:#ffc05e}.q-card .info{background-color:#f0f0f0;border-radius:5px;color:#555;display:inline-block;font-size:.8em;margin-bottom:2px;margin-right:2px;padding:2px 8px}.q-card .info .q-icon{margin-right:3px}.q-card .warn{background-color:#f44336;border-radius:5px;color:#fff;display:inline-block;font-size:.8em;margin-bottom:2px;margin-right:2px;padding:2px}.q-card .warn .q-icon{margin-left:3px;margin-right:3px}ol.instructions-list li{line-height:2}@keyframes pulse{0%{box-shadow:0 0 0 0 rgba(33,150,243,.7);transform:scale(1)}70%{box-shadow:0 0 0 15px rgba(33,150,243,0);transform:scale(1.05)}to{box-shadow:0 0 0 0 rgba(33,150,243,0);transform:scale(1)}}.pulse-btn{animation:pulse 2s infinite}@keyframes breathing{0%,to{opacity:1}50%{opacity:.5}}.breathing-btn{animation:breathing 2s ease-in-out infinite}.bars{align-items:flex-end;display:flex;gap:4px;height:15px}.bars span{animation:pulse_bar 1s ease-in-out infinite;background:#2196f3;display:block;width:4px}.bars span:nth-child(2){animation-delay:.1s}.bars span:nth-child(3){animation-delay:.2s}.bars span:nth-child(4){animation-delay:.3s}.bars span:nth-child(5){animation-delay:.4s}@keyframes pulse_bar{0%,to{height:3px}50%{height:15px}}